About this series
The twins are still missing.
Months have passed but Emiel searches still. Amiya and Nandi are out there somewhere, and no predator or monster, or creature from the underworld will stop him from saving his daughters. But there is a cost. As Emiel embraces the power of the essences, will he learn to control them or will they destroy him before he has a chance to save his beloved twins?
Shurza is free.
Once contained but now unleashed, Shurza, the blight essence, casts its lengthening shadow across Marai, leaving death and ruin in its wake. With it's escape, so too have awakened the fallen. The powerful servants of Shurza scheme against one another, using the people of Marai and Khatal as their unwitting pawns in a play to bring the Order of Magi to its knees and free themselves from their binding with Shurza.
The Illuminarians awaken.
Heroes from ages long past awaken once more. For millennia and more they were trapped in the void prison with the fallen and Shurza, and it has taken a toll. Weakened and mentally damaged, the illuminarians hold the power to defeat the fallen and destroy Shurza, or tear the world apart.

In the bone-chilling spring, spice trades are lucrative and exhausting, and Emiel Dharr wants nothing more than to come home to a hot meal with his beloved daughters. But when he returns to an empty home and a note detailing his daughters' kidnappings, the horror-stricken spicetrader will lose them forever unless he travels beside a mercenary and a mysterious magus to the imposing city of Altarra to free them. Beside unfriendly companions, Emiel travels across lands darkening under the specter of war, and finds himself targeted by ruthless leaders scrambling for an advantage. Nothing will stop him from saving his daughters, but the road becomes ever-more dangerous as monsters unseen for generations suddenly appear. Facing death at every step of his journey, Emiel accidentally awakens a terrifying power inside him. Is this coincidence, or is something more sinister at play? With a frightening inner power growing inside him, Emiel's time is limited. War lies ahead, predators dog his trail, and hideous monsters threaten his life. So be it. About the Author Ramon Terrell is an actor and author who instantly fell in love with fantasy the day he opened R. A. Salvatore’s: The Crystal Shard. Years (and many devoured books) later he decided to put pen to paper for his first novel. After a bout with aching carpals, he decided to try the keyboard instead, and the words began to flow. As an actor, he has appeared in the hit television shows Supernatural, izombie, Arrow, and Minority Report, as well as the hit comedy web series Single and Dating in Vancouver. He also appears as one of Robin Hood’s Merry Men in Once Upon a Time, as well as an Ark Guard on the hit TV show The 100. When not writing, or acting on set, he enjoys reading, video games, hiking, and long walks with his wife around Stanley Park in Vancouver BC.
